About Rennes, France Hotel Booking

Rennes, the capital of France’s Brittany region, is a well-established city known for its historical heritage and contemporary urban character. The city is recognised for its half-timbered architecture, historic landmarks, and well-used public squares. Alongside its cultural heritage, Rennes is also a prominent academic and administrative centre.

Rennes offers strong transport connectivity and convenient access to nearby destinations. The city is well connected to Paris and other major French destinations by high-speed trains. Best Areas to Stay in Rennes, France - Choose the Right Location

Before booking accommodation in Rennes, travellers should consider the purpose of their visit. Selecting the right neighbourhood can significantly enhance convenience for sightseeing, dining, shopping, and access to public transportation.

  • Rennes City Centre: The historic city centre is the vibrant heart of Rennes, where centuries-old half-timbered houses sit alongside lively squares filled with cafés, boutiques, and local activity. Staying in this area places travellers within easy walking distance of key landmarks, making it especially appealing for first-time visitors.
  • Thabor–Saint Hélier: This area is especially valued for Parc du Thabor, one of France’s most admired public gardens. Staying here offers a sense of tranquillity while still being close to Rennes city centre. It is well-suited to families and travellers who enjoy green surroundings and a slower, more relaxed pace.
  • Villejean–Beauregard: Located just beyond Rennes’ historic centre, this neighbourhood has a youthful and lively atmosphere shaped by its nearby universities. It is a practical choice for travellers seeking more affordable accommodation. Reliable metro and bus links make it easy to reach central Rennes.

How to Reach Rennes, France?

Located in the Brittany region of northwestern France, Rennes is a well-connected city and easily accessible for travellers planning hotel or flight bookings. Rennes can be reached conveniently by air, train, or road.

  • By Air: For flight bookings, Rennes Bretagne Airport (RNS), officially known as Rennes–Saint-Jacques Airport, is located just about 11 km from the city centre, making air travel to Rennes both quick and convenient. Travellers can also book flights to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port (CDG), located 370 km away, and then continue onward to Rennes by train or road transport. From Rennes Bretagne Airport (RNS), the city centre can be reached comfortably by taxi or public transport.
  • By Train: Gare de Rennes is the city’s main railway station and a key hub on France’s high-speed rail network, making train travel one of the most convenient ways to reach Rennes. The station is served by frequent TGV services from Paris Montparnasse, with a journey time of approximately 1 hour and 30 minutes.
  • By Road: Rennes is well connected by a modern highway network, making road travel smooth and convenient. The city can be reached by car via the A11 motorway, which links Paris to western France, followed by the A81 towards Rennes. In addition to private vehicles and taxis, long-distance buses offer frequent, affordable services.
